Australia’s Commanding Start in Colombo

The Australia vs Sri Lanka 2025 ODI series kicked off with a bang in Colombo today, as the visitors delivered a dominant performance in the first ODI. Steve Smith’s men showcased their depth in both bowling and fielding, reducing Sri Lanka to 135/8 in 33 overs before rain interrupted play. Match Highlights: Sri Lanka’s Batting Collapse

  1. Early Wickets Rock Sri Lanka
    Australia’s pace attack, led by Spencer Johnson (2/37) and Aaron Hardie (2/12), dismantled Sri Lanka’s top order. Openers Pathum Nissanka and Avishka Fernando fell cheaply, leaving the hosts reeling at 6/2 in 2 overs .
  2. Asalanka’s Lone Fight
    Skipper Charith Asalanka (50* off 73) stood tall amid the chaos, anchoring partnerships with Dunith Wellalage (30) and Wanindu Hasaranga (7). His gritty half-century included six boundaries, but lack of support from the lower order left Sri Lanka struggling .
  3. Steve Smith’s Fielding Masterclass
    Smith stole the spotlight with two sensational catches. His one-handed grab to dismiss Wellalage off Matt Short’s bowling was hailed as “genius” by commentator Simon Katich. Earlier, he snapped a low catch at slip to send Janith Liyanage packing .
  4. Nathan Ellis’ Precision
    Ellis (2/11) cleaned up the tail, including a crucial dismissal of Maheesh Theekshana after a controversial DRS review. His disciplined line exploited Sri Lanka’s shaky footwork .

Series Context: Australia’s Champions Trophy Prep

This two-match ODI series serves as Australia’s final tune-up before the 2025 ICC Champions Trophy. Despite missing star quicks Pat Cummins, Mitchell Starc, and Josh Hazlewood, their bench strength shone through. Steve Smith’s leadership and all-round contributions (as both captain and fielder) have set a strong tone .
